Defendants may pay the total price of the bail, go for a property bond or try to gain a launch through their own recognizance. States set the payment for a bail bond, and in most states, the fee is 10 p.c of the total bail.
At the defendant’s arraignment or a separate bail hearing, the decide will set bail by considering the bail schedule and other related elements, as mentioned below. Alternatively, the choose could launch the defendant on his or her own recognizance, which can also be mentioned in additional element under. California legislation also permits courts to cut back bail following a change in circumstances. Specifically, Penal Code § 1289 authorizes a court to cut back the bail if good cause is shown.
